After the competition on the second day of the 2019 Doha track and field world championships, the Chinese team won the first gold of the world championships. In the women's 50km Race Walking Competition, Liang Rui has always been in the leading position. She won the championship in 4 hours, 23 minutes and 26 seconds, and Li maocuo won the silver medal. In the men's 50km walking race, Niu Wenbin didn't hold the second place in the last 5km. He finally won the fourth place. Unfortunately, he missed the medal, and Suzuki xiongsuke of Japan won the title.

The Chinese team sent Li maocuo, Liang Rui and Ma faying to participate in the women's 50km walking competition. After the start of the game, Li maocuo and Liang Rui took the lead with the defending champion Henriquez of Portugal and Giorgio of Italy. At 20km, the four person leading square was divided, Liang Rui and Henriquez continued to take the lead, Li maocuo fell 10 seconds behind and ranked third, and keoggi fell to fourth, 20 seconds behind the leader.

In the next 5 kilometers, Liang Rui remained stable and continued to take the lead. Henriquez was a little out of physical strength and slowed down. Li maocuo and kioggi surpassed her one after another. At the end of the race, Liang Rui took the lead alone in 2 hours, 15 minutes and 04 seconds, Li maocuo was second behind by 14 seconds, and kioggi was third behind by 37 seconds. Ma faying ranked seventh with a score of 2 hours and 19 minutes. After the competition, Liang Rui and Li maocuo firmly occupied the top two. They threw other players away. At the end of 40km, Liang Rui ranked first with 2 hours, 40 minutes and 54 seconds, Li maocuo ranked second with 17 seconds behind, and keoggi ranked third with 1 minute and 49 seconds behind.

After the competition, Liang Rui continued to expand her leading position. At the end of 45km, she was 2 minutes and 28 seconds ahead of her second teammate Li maocuo. In the last 5 kilometers, Liang Rui's leading edge was hard to shake. She took the lead in hitting the line in 4 hours, 23 minutes and 26 seconds to win the championship. Li maocuo passed the finish line in 4 hours, 26 minutes and 40 seconds, and she won the silver medal.

In the men's 50km Race Walking Competition, the Chinese team has Wang Qin, Niu Wenbin and Luo Yadong. After the start of the competition, Japan's Suzuki xiongsuke took the lead and rushed to the front. The three players of the Chinese team were in the generous array, closely following Suzuki xiongsuke. Defending champion France's Deniz gradually accelerated after 5K. He caught up with Suzuki xiongsuke and LED together. Wang Qin, Luo Yadong and Niu Wenbin were in the third square, more than 49 seconds behind the leader. At 15km, Dinitz's speed slowed down, and his ranking fell to 12th. After that, his physical condition became more and more unsatisfactory, so he had to choose to withdraw from the race.

Suzuki xiongjie was in excellent condition. He threw others away and became a lonely leader. At the end of 25km, his score was 2 hours, 01 minutes and 07 seconds. After 5 kilometers, Suzuki still took the lead. At the end of 30 kilometers, the result was 2 hours, 25 minutes and 55 seconds. Luo Yadong and Niu Wenbin have been walking at their own pace. They rose to No. 2 and No. 3 at the end of 30 kilometers, of which Luo Yadong fell behind Suzuki xiongsuke by 2 minutes and 59 seconds.

After the competition, Suzuki remained in the lead, but his speed gradually slowed down after 40 kilometers. Niu Wenbin tried to narrow the gap with him. At 45 kilometers, Suzuki continued to lead with 3 hours, 38 minutes and 41 seconds, and Niu Wenbin ranked second behind 2 minutes and 05 seconds. Luo Yadong is physically overdrawn and has fallen to No. 5 in the ranking. In the next competition, Niu Wenbin gradually narrowed the gap with Suzuki xiongsuke, but two red cards made him afraid to completely speed up and catch up.

In the last period, Suzuki remained in the lead. He took the lead in hitting the line and winning the championship in 4 hours, 04 minutes and 20 seconds. Niu Wenbin didn't keep his second place and was overtaken by his opponent. Portuguese 43 year old Vieira, who participated in the world championships for the 11th time, won the second place in 4 hours, 04 minutes and 59 seconds. This is his first world championship medal and he is also the oldest medal winner in the history of the world championships. Canada's Deng Fei took the bronze medal in 4 hours, 05 minutes and 02 seconds, Niu Wenbin took the fourth in 4 hours, 05 minutes and 36 seconds, and Luo Yadong took the fifth in 4 hours, 06 minutes and 49 seconds.
